I’ve two AbsoluteLayout are called Background_layout and Foreground_layout in one base XML.

I wanna move first layout (Background_layout) through the accelerometer sensor for direction Y X Z , How can i do that?

Here you can see my XML :

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<AbsoluteLayout 
x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
android:id="@+id/background_layout" 
android:background="@drawable/background" 
android:layout_width="fill_parent" 
android:layout_height="fill_parent" 
>
<AbsoluteLayout 
android:id="@+id/foreground_layout" 
android:layout_height="wrap_content" 
android:background="@drawable/foreground" 
android:layout_width="wrap_content" 
android:layout_x="0dip" 
android:layout_y="0dip">
</AbsoluteLayout>
</AbsoluteLayout>

I have all the values about direction , But I don’t know How can I use them in layout view.

 public void onSensorChanged(int sensor, float[] values) {
    synchronized (this) {
    if (sensor == SensorManager.SENSOR_ACCELEROMETER) {
    float ValuX = (float) values[0];
    float ValuY = (float) values[1];
    float ValuZ = (float) values[2];
    int ResValuX  = new Integer(Float.toString(ValuX));
    int ResValuY  = new Integer(Float.toString(ValuY));
    int ResValuZ  = new Integer(Float.toString(ValuZ));
    Background.addView(Background,ResValuX);
    Background.addView(Background,ResValuY);
    Background.addView(Background,ResValuZ);
    }
    }
    }

Any suggestion would be appreciated.

    If you get values from the accelerometer, then you can update the postition of views by setting their layout parameters. To move the views to left, you could set the value as the left margin.

    LinearLayout.LayoutParams lp = LinearLayout.LayoutParams(LayoutParams.WRAP_CONTENT
            ,LayoutParams.WRAP_CONTENT);
    lp.leftMargin = 10;
    view.setLayoutParameters(lp);
    

    This should work.
